Thảo luận Bản mẫu:Hộp thông tin

(Đổi hướng từ Thảo luận Mô đun:Infobox)
Bình luận mới nhất: 3 năm trước bởi Prenn trong đề tài Yêu cầu sửa đổi ngày 26 tháng 8 năm 2020

Doc sửa

Bản mẫu này chủ yếu được sử dụng để tạo các bản mẫu khác

{{Infobox
|name     = {{subst:PAGENAME}}
|bodystyle= 
|title    = Tiêu đề
|titlestyle= 
|above    = Tên đối tượng
|abovestyle= 
|subheader= Tên phụ của đối tượng
|subheaderstyle= 
|subheader2= Tên phụ 2 của đối tượng
|image    = [[Tập tin:khong hinh tu do.svg|250px]]
|imagestyle = 
|caption  = Xin hãy giúp Wiki bằng một <br>[[Wikipedia:Quy định sử dụng hình ảnh|'''hình ảnh có bản quyền''']]
|captionstyle  = 
|image2   = [[Tập tin:Vi-alt-nu-1.png|250px]]
|caption2 = Xin hãy giúp Wiki bằng một <br>[[Wikipedia:Quy định sử dụng hình ảnh|'''hình ảnh có bản quyền''']]
|headerstyle   = 
|labelstyle    = 
|datastyle     = 
|header1  = Đầu đề
|label1   = Nhãn mục 1
|data1    = Dữ liệu 1
|header2  = 
|label2   = 
|data2    = 
|header3  = 
|label3   = 
|data3    = 
|header4  = 
|label4   = 
|data4    = 
|header5  = 
|label5   = 
|data5    = 
|header6  = 
|label6   = 
|data6    = 
|header7  = 
|label7   = 
|data7    = 
|header8  = 
|label8   = 
|data8    = 
|header9  = 
|label9   = 
|data9    = 
|header10 = 
|label10  = 
|data10   = 
|header11 = 
|label11  = 
|data11   = 
|header12 = 
|label12  = 
|data12   = 
|header13 = 
|label13  = 
|data13   = 
|header14 = 
|label14  = 
|data14   = 
|header15 = 
|label15  = 
|data15   = 
|header16 = 
|label16  = 
|data16   = 
|header17 = 
|label17  = 
|data17   = 
|header18 = 
|label18  = 
|data18   = 
|header19 = 
|label19  = 
|data19   = 
|header20 = 
|label20  = 
|data20   = 
|belowstyle =
|below = 
}}

Xem thử ví dụ tại Bản mẫu:Thông tin sách Newone (thảo luận) 09:39, ngày 29 tháng 11 năm 2010 (UTC)Trả lời

Hiển thị xấu sửa

Xin chào Mxn, Trần Nguyễn Minh HuyPinus (ba bạn đã từng tham gia sửa mô đun này). Mình vô tình để ý đến điều này trong khi viết bài. Vấn đề dường như nằm ở phần mã CSS được quy định bởi mô đun này vì tất cả các Infobox đều bị ảnh hưởng. Khi một giá trị của headerndatan là một văn bản dài hoặc một danh sách dài, các dòng bị sát lại vào nhau, trông xấu. Ví dụ tại 21 (album của Adele), Nguyễn Huệ, Tiếng Anh. Xin hãy lưu ý và xem xét, cảm ơn các bạn! Tran Xuan Hoa (thảo luận) 21:36, ngày 30 tháng 10 năm 2015 (UTC)Trả lời

Tại MediaWiki:Common.css tôi đã giảm kích cỡ chữ từ 0.9em xuống 0.88em và tăng kích thước giữa các dòng từ 1.15em lên 1.25em. Chắc đã đẹp và dễ đọc hơn rồi. — Pinus|tl 02:05, ngày 31 tháng 10 năm 2015 (UTC)Trả lời
Trông đã tốt hơn rồi! Tran Xuan Hoa (thảo luận) 21:30, ngày 1 tháng 11 năm 2015 (UTC)Trả lời

Yêu cầu sửa đổi trang bị khóa ngày 18 tháng 11 năm 2017 sửa

Có thể chỉnh sửa như bên en được ko ạ? Vì nó đã nâng cấp rồi ạ.

WAYNE MARK ROONEYR10 11:49, ngày 18 tháng 11 năm 2017 (UTC)Trả lời

Yêu cầu sửa đổi ngày 26 tháng 8 năm 2020 sửa

Đề xuất xóa dòng :css('padding', '2px') trong hàm addRow. Hiện cái này sẽ override padding đã định sẵn trong skin Vector của Wiki, làm những infobox của các thành phố có padding rất nhỏ, chữ gần sát cạnh. Mình thấy không có nhiều tác dụng, bên en cũng không còn; và chỉ là CSS nên chắc không có thay đổi đáng kể gì.

TrunghaiTĐN (thảo luận) 07:09, ngày 26 tháng 8 năm 2020 (UTC)Trả lời

@TrunghaiTĐN: Thay đổi này đã được thực hiện theo yêu cầu, nhưng tôi mạn phép lùi lại để nhờ bạn việc này. Việc đặt giá trị padding=2px giúp làm tăng chiều cao của hàng có màu nền trong một số infobox như {{Thông tin sân bay}}, {{Thông tin quốc gia}} vốn chỉ vừa cao hơn chữ một chút, xóa giá trị này sẽ thu nhỏ vùng màu nền lại chỉ vừa đủ bao quanh chữ ([1]). Tôi tìm lại cũng không thấy padding cho hàng được định nghĩa ở đâu khác. Vì vậy nhờ bạn screenshot lại vấn đề bạn gặp phải như trong thảo luận trước (tôi đã lùi lại về bản cũ của module này) và nhờ bạn chỉ giúp tôi padding trước đó đã được định nghĩa ở đâu để tôi xem thử nhé. Nếu cần, tôi nghĩ có thể đặt giá trị padding lớn hơn thay vì 2px. — Prenn + 02:53, ngày 10 tháng 9 năm 2020 (UTC)Trả lời
@Prenn: Bài mình nói là bài Tallinn, dùng Bản mẫu:Thông tin khu dân cư. [2]
Bên en họ để .infobox { padding: 0.2em; } trong en:Mediwiki:Common.css, nên là không cần dòng :css('padding', '2px') trong Mô đun của họ (mà 2px theo mình cũng không đủ rộng). Nên mình thấy thêm dòng padding: 0.2em; vô phần .infobox trong Common.css là tốt nhất, khỏi mò trong Mô đun chi cho mệt. — TrunghaiTĐN (talk) 05:27, ngày 10 tháng 9 năm 2020 (UTC)Trả lời
Cảm ơn bạn TrunghaiTĐN đã phản hồi. Tôi đã thêm padding vào {{Thông tin khu dân cư}} và tăng padding cho kiểu infobox geography trong MediaWiki:Common.css để tạm giải quyết vấn đề bạn yêu cầu bên trên (nếu giờ khoảng cách lại quá nhiều thì bạn nhắn lại nhé). Sở dĩ tôi không thêm trực tiếp vào kiểu infobox trong MediaWiki:Common.css và cũng không muốn can thiệp vào Mô đun:Infobox là vì tại Wikipedia tiếng Việt có nhiều bản mẫu infobox (có thể kể đến bản mẫu:Thông tin animanga) đã được tinh chỉnh qua thời gian dài để thể hiện đúng từng pixel và việc điều chỉnh padding đối với toàn bộ bản mẫu infobox có nghĩa là bạn sẽ phải sửa lại từng bản mẫu đó cho phù hợp. Đồng thời như bạn thấy thì {{Thông tin khu dân cư}} là một trong số ít bản mẫu sử dụng kiểu dáng cũ của infobox mà hiện giờ Wikipedia tiếng Việt vẫn còn dùng, nên can thiệp trực tiếp vào bản mẫu này sẽ tốt hơn thay vì thay đổi ở bản mẫu gốc. Sắp tới nếu tôi có thời gian, tôi sẽ cập nhật lại kiểu dáng của bản mẫu này cho giống với các bản mẫu khác như {{Thông tin đơn vị hành chính Việt Nam}}, {{Thông tin quốc gia}}... khi đó sẽ không cần định nghĩa infobox geography trong Common.css nữa. Cũng để bạn hiểu rằng đôi lúc các định nghĩa kiểu dáng mà chúng ta sử dụng tại đây, so với enwiki thì cũng đã được tùy biến cho phù hợp qua quá trình sử dụng. P/S: Bạn đọc bài Tallinn chắc mới xem xong Tenet. — Prenn + 16:31, ngày 10 tháng 9 năm 2020 (UTC)Trả lời
Quay lại trang “Hộp thông tin”.